As the cartographer for the Congressional Cartography Program, I create maps and perform geospatial analyses for congressional staff looking for spatial insights. Mapping projects range from reference maps of congressional districts to detailed analyses of policy issues and their impacts across local, state, and national scales. Congressional requests and resulting products are confidential to the requesting office, but I can share the below map, showing gender-earnings ratio by congressional district. This map was published in "Gender Pay Inequality: Consequences for Women, Family and the Economy," a 2016 report by the Democratic staff of the Joint Economic Committee of the U.S. Senate.
